CLAIM FOR DAMAGES

— PresB Asnociatfon,)

Question of; Contributory Negligence •APPEAL DISMISSED

(By Teleeraph

j WELLINGTON, April 19. Judgment in tbo case of'Ling Bing v. Tbomas Walton Bobertwn was de•livered by tbe Court of Appeal to-dayf :The judgment was delivered by Mr Juatiee U»tier, wbose judgment was agreed witb by Mr Justiee Jobnson and in a scparato judgment by Mr Justiee Smitb. Tbe case arqse out of a cqjllision. As to * point made by appellaut tbat upon xespondeat's Own evidenpq be was guilty of contributory neglb gence debarrjpg his yigbt to recover damages from respondent, it was hejd tbere was ample evidenee to justify tbe jury in acoepting respondent Btatement of fact tbat tbe lorry qf nppellant bad left no room on tbe road for Mm to pass anj, therefore, to bold that as tbe vaccident would bave bappened wherever respondent had been on tbe road, bis negligence in not travelling to tbe extreme left was not contributory negligence. On tbe question of whetber appellant wa» entitled to a new trial on tbe grpund tbat tbe jury's verdict was defective, it was stated tbat tbe answer to tbe first issue was not a very intelligpnt qso, but in view of the course whicb tho frial tOOk the answer was not realjy so ambiguous that it« meaning could not be gathered witb reasonable certainty. Tbe appeal must be dismjssed witb eogtg on tbe bigbfft scale.
